Heim  >  Artikel  >  Backend-Entwicklung  >  Empfohlene 10 AppDomain-Quellcodes (Sammlung)

Empfohlene 10 AppDomain-Quellcodes (Sammlung)

巴扎黑
巴扎黑Original
2017-06-12 14:14:121402Durchsuche

Um das Problem klar zu beschreiben, schauen wir uns zunächst ein Beispiel an. In diesem Beispiel gibt es eine Schaltfläche auf der WinForm. Wenn der Benutzer auf die Schaltfläche klickt, wird eine vorhandene Assembly geladen und der vollständige Name der Assembly wird im Label-Steuerelement der Schnittstelle angezeigt. Freunde, die mit Reflection ein wenig vertraut sind, wissen, dass dies eine sehr einfache Sache ist. Sie müssen nur die Assembly.LoadFile-Methode verwenden, um die Assembly abzurufen, und dann das FullName-Attribut verwenden, um sie anzuzeigen. Zum Beispiel der folgende Code: private void button1_Click(Objektsender, EventArgs e ) { Assembly Assembly = Assembly.LoadFile(@"C:t

1. Detaillierte Erläuterung des dynamischen Lade- und Entladecodes von AppDomain und Assembly

Empfohlene 10 AppDomain-Quellcodes (Sammlung)

Einleitung: Um das Problem klar zu beschreiben, schauen wir uns zunächst ein Beispiel an. In diesem Beispiel gibt es eine Schaltfläche Wenn der Benutzer auf diese Schaltfläche klickt, wird eine vorhandene Assembly geladen und der vollständige Name der Assembly wird im Label-Steuerelement der Benutzeroberfläche angezeigt. Freunde, die mit Reflection ein wenig vertraut sind, wissen, dass dies eine sehr einfache Angelegenheit ist Verwenden Sie die Assembly.LoadFile-Methode, um die Assembly abzurufen, und verwenden Sie dann einfach das FullName-Attribut, um sie anzuzeigen, z. B. das folgende

2

Empfohlene 10 AppDomain-Quellcodes (Sammlung)

Einführung: .net-Code private Type GetType(string className) { // Erstellt aktuelle AppDomain currentDomain = AppDomain .CurrentDomain; // Erstellt ein Array für die Liste der Assemblys.

3

Einführung: Zugang Problembeschreibung: Manchmal ist es erforderlich, den erforderlichen Datensatz in den Tabellen von zwei oder drei Datenbanken über verwandte Schlüsselwörter abzufragen. Dies kann mit gewöhnlichen SQL-Abfrageanweisungen nicht erreicht werden. Dies kann durch die datenbankübergreifende Abfragefunktion von ACCESS erreicht werden . Lösung: Die beiden Tabellen „Content Type“ und „Content Material“ befinden sich beispielsweise in unterschiedlichen Datenbanken. Die spezifische Abfragemethode lautet wie folgt: @„Select * from Container Type as a INNER JOIN [;database=" AppDomain

【Verwandte Q&A-Empfehlungen】:

Das obige ist der detaillierte Inhalt vonEmpfohlene 10 AppDomain-Quellcodes (Sammlung).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n